June 15, 2016 Read time: 1 min
Work on a major interchange project in the UAE is on track. The US$184.3 million interchange project includes building a new road link to Abu Dhabi’s International Airport. The work is complex, with 5.6km of connecting roads, 4.8km of bridges and an overpass and underpass that provide a connection for the E12 route leading to Yas Island. Highway widening work is also included as well as the construction of secondary roads and a new drainage system to handle floodwater. The work has been needed to meet anticipated growth in traffic, with upgrades to the airport facilities helping to fuel demand for additional transport capacity.
